478 * RPC broadcast interface
479 * The call is broadcasted to all locally connected nets.
481 * extern enum clnt_stat
482 * rpc_broadcast(prog, vers, proc, xargs, argsp, xresults, resultsp,
483 * eachresult, nettype)
484 * const rpcprog_t prog; -- program number
485 * const rpcvers_t vers; -- version number
486 * const rpcproc_t proc; -- procedure number
487 * const xdrproc_t xargs; -- xdr routine for args
488 * caddr_t argsp; -- pointer to args
489 * const xdrproc_t xresults; -- xdr routine for results
490 * caddr_t resultsp; -- pointer to results
491 * const resultproc_t eachresult; -- call with each result
492 * const char *nettype; -- Transport type
494 * For each valid response received, the procedure eachresult is called.
496 * done = eachresult(resp, raddr, nconf)
499 * struct netbuf *raddr;
500 * struct netconfig *nconf;
501 * where resp points to the results of the call and raddr is the
502 * address if the responder to the broadcast. nconf is the transport
503 * on which the response was received.
